If you are instructed to report for jury service, you are entitled to a $50.00 attendance fee for each day of attendance and 67 cents per mile, round trip, even if you take public transportation. County of Sacramento provides fair, equal ...The court staff will call some people from the audience section to sit in the jury box. They'll ask those people questions. Some of them will be dismissed; when that happens, they'll be replaced with new people from the audience. At some point they'll get a final jury. If you're not on the jury, you're done and you go home.Emergency Contact Information. Jury Duty Scam. FAQs. Our staff will NEVER contact jurors by phone regarding failure to serve jury duty. Our staff will not ask any jurors for information such as credit card numbers, bank account or other personal information such as Social Security numbers. Never provide this type of information to anyone claiming to be associated with the court.

California Rules of Court, Rule 2.1008. If you do not go to jury duty when summoned, the judge will typically issue you a second summons. If you continue to not go to jury duty, you can be held in contempt of court. Contempt of court can carry a fine or even jail time. California law requires a fair cross-section of each county's qualified residents to be available each day for jury duty. When a jury trial is about to begin, the trial court judge requests a panel of prospective jurors to be sent to the courtroom from the jury assembly room so that the jury selection process can begin. After reporting to a courtroom, the prospective jurors are first required to swear that they will truthfully answer ...

A juror who is lawfully notified to attend court is subject to a fine of not less than $100 nor more than $500 if that juror either: fails to attend court in obedience to the notice without a reasonable excuse; or. files a false claim of exemption from jury service. Supervisors must temporarily adjust an employee's work schedule, if other than Monday through Friday, 8 a.m. to 5 p.m., until the employee is released from Jury Duty.Jury duty notices from Superior Court will include a text box that says "Official Jury Notice" in all capital white letters against a black background. This will be on the front of the postcard where your address is listed. This same side of the postcard will include: Your group number. Your candidate identification (ID) number. This is a sub about Sacramento and the greater Sacramento region consisting of the following nine…2024 California Rules of Court. Rule 2.1008. Excuses from jury service. (a) Duty of citizenship. Jury service, unless excused by law, is a responsibility of citizenship. The court and its staff must employ all necessary and appropriate means to ensure that citizens fulfill this important civic responsibility. (Subd (a) amended effective January ... Each year, the grand jury issues a report based on its investigations. These reports include findings and recommendations which must be addressed by the agency involved. In most cases, the entity has 90 days to respond. 2022-2023.icsk8grrl • 2 yr. ago.
